Description
English: A PCD (Photoconductance decay)-calibrated photoluminescence image showing the change in passivation quality (minority carrier lifetimes) after dark annealing a 4-inch p-type monocrystalline float zone silicon wafer coated with 10nm layer of intrinsic amorphous silicon at various temperatures for 50 seconds. The images were taken as a differential of two images registered using LumiTools ICARUS.
